[ovs-discuss] ipfix leads to kernel crash

ZHANG Zhiming zhangzhiming at yunshan.net.cn
Mon Nov 2 14:12:32 UTC 2015


Could someone help me check this kernel crash?
I set ipfix to send report to a collector, and the kernel crashed after several hours.

ovs-vsctl (Open vSwitch) 2.3.1
Compiled Aug 11 2015 05:18:30
DB Schema 7.6.2

kernel version:

crash> bt
PID: 1614   TASK: ffff8817fb7638e0  CPU: 1   COMMAND: "avahi-daemon"
 #0 [ffff8817f78c71e8] machine_kexec at ffffffff8104105b
 #1 [ffff8817f78c7248] crash_kexec at ffffffff810ceec2
 #2 [ffff8817f78c7318] oops_end at ffffffff815e9b08
 #3 [ffff8817f78c7340] die at ffffffff810162ab
 #4 [ffff8817f78c7370] do_trap at ffffffff815e91e0
 #5 [ffff8817f78c73c0] do_invalid_op at ffffffff810130d4
 #6 [ffff8817f78c7470] invalid_op at ffffffff815f2d9e
    [exception RIP: pskb_expand_head+526]
    RIP: ffffffff814c107e  RSP: ffff8817f78c7528  RFLAGS: 00010202
    RAX: 0000000000000002  RBX: ffff8817fb2e1700  RCX: 0000000000000020
    RDX: 00000000000002c0  RSI: 0000000000000000  RDI: ffff8817fb2e1700
    RBP: ffff8817f78c7560   R8: 0000000000000132   R9: 0000000000000000
    R10: 0000000000000100  R11: 0000000000000004  R12: 0000000000000000
    R13: ffff8817fb2e1700  R14: 00000000958819e2  R15: ffff8817fab82500
    ORIG_RAX: ffffffffffffffff  CS: 0010  SS: 0018
 #7 [ffff8817f78c7568] skb_checksum_help at ffffffff814cd85b
 #8 [ffff8817f78c7598] queue_userspace_packet at ffffffffa043cf03 [openvswitch]
 #9 [ffff8817f78c7638] ovs_dp_upcall at ffffffffa043e5a5 [openvswitch]
#10 [ffff8817f78c7650] do_execute_actions at ffffffffa043aa0e [openvswitch]
#11 [ffff8817f78c76f0] do_execute_actions at ffffffffa043aa3b [openvswitch]
#12 [ffff8817f78c7790] ovs_execute_actions at ffffffffa043b3f7 [openvswitch]
#13 [ffff8817f78c77c8] ovs_dp_process_packet_with_key at ffffffffa043e64e [openvswitch]
#14 [ffff8817f78c7838] ovs_dp_process_received_packet at ffffffffa043e794 [openvswitch]
#15 [ffff8817f78c7900] ovs_vport_receive at ffffffffa0444d7a [openvswitch]
#16 [ffff8817f78c7910] internal_dev_xmit at ffffffffa0445a4d [openvswitch]
#17 [ffff8817f78c7920] dev_hard_start_xmit at ffffffff814d10f8
#18 [ffff8817f78c7978] dev_queue_xmit at ffffffff814d1680
#19 [ffff8817f78c79c8] ip_finish_output at ffffffff8150d321
#20 [ffff8817f78c7a18] ip_mc_output at ffffffff8150e53a
#21 [ffff8817f78c7a48] ip_local_out at ffffffff8150dec5
#22 [ffff8817f78c7a60] ip_send_skb at ffffffff8150f235
#23 [ffff8817f78c7a78] udp_send_skb at ffffffff81534ea2
#24 [ffff8817f78c7ab8] udp_sendmsg at ffffffff81535e37
#25 [ffff8817f78c7bd8] inet_sendmsg at ffffffff81542074
#26 [ffff8817f78c7c08] sock_sendmsg at ffffffff814b6f30
#27 [ffff8817f78c7d70] ___sys_sendmsg at ffffffff814b7369
#28 [ffff8817f78c7f00] __sys_sendmsg at ffffffff814b8251
#29 [ffff8817f78c7f70] sys_sendmsg at ffffffff814b82a2
#30 [ffff8817f78c7f80] system_call_fastpath at ffffffff815f1659
    RIP: 00007f48906247a0  RSP: 00007fff5ee93768  RFLAGS: 00000207
    RAX: 000000000000002e  RBX: ffffffff815f1659  RCX: 00007f48912d3e20
    RDX: 0000000000000000  RSI: 00007fff5ee93fa0  RDI: 000000000000000c
    RBP: 000000000000000c   R8: 00007fff5ee93f13   R9: 0000000000000004
    R10: 0000000000000019  R11: 0000000000000246  R12: ffffffff814b82a2
    R13: ffff8817f78c7f78  R14: 000000000000000c  R15: 00007fff5ee93fa0
    ORIG_RAX: 000000000000002e  CS: 0033  SS: 002b
crash> sys
      KERNEL: /usr/lib/debug/lib/modules/3.10.0-123.el7.x86_64/vmlinux
        CPUS: 8
        DATE: Fri Oct 23 22:15:37 2015
      UPTIME: 00:00:21
LOAD AVERAGE: 1.01, 0.24, 0.08
       TASKS: 445
    NODENAME: centos131
     RELEASE: 3.10.0-123.el7.x86_64
     VERSION: #1 SMP Tue Jul 14 11:00:37 CST 2015
     MACHINE: x86_64  (2500 Mhz)
      MEMORY: 96 GB
       PANIC: "kernel BUG at net/core/skbuff.c:1060!"

ZHANG Zhiming
